Investment firm CVC Capital Partners has denied making an improved bid to acquire a stake in the enterprise services division of Telecom Italia (TIM). CVC submitted a proposal in March to buy 49% of the business, valuing the entire unit at EUR6 billion (USD6 billion). The firm is refuting local press reports that it has increased its valuation to around EUR7 billion, saying: ‘The only proposal made to TIM’s board was dated 25 March 2022, as announced by TIM on 28 March.’
